I doubt you will see TED this summer, or if you'll see him at all. CLE was a potential TED city from DEN, you are right, but ORD was also going to be a TED home and nearly every WN city was going to be served somehow by TED. In the report it listed TED's fleet size to be almost 140 planes strong-now it is only forcast to be 29% of that.
The only true routes that panned out from that report were:
SFO-LAS
DEN-LAS
LAX-LAS
DEN-MSY
DEN-RNO
DEN-FLL
DEN-TPA
But if CLE is anything like CMH, the Shuttle (E-) aircraft are flying nearly all the flights. I would say about 66% of my 737's in and out of CMH have been the E- types. Can't wait for the RJ that is coming in January
